    Combined radar and lidar cloud remote sensing: Comparison with IR radiometer and in-situ measurements

    No full text
    International audienceA new combined radar and lidar inversion procedure has been developed for cloud particle effective radius and water content retrievals. The algorithm uses the radar reflectivity and an effective particle size to parameterize the extinction at the lidar wavelength while treating the derived sizes and lidar multiple scattering effects in a consistent fashion. This procedure has been applied to data from the CLouds And RAdiation experiment (CLARA) and the Cloud Lidar and Radar Experiment (CLARE' 98) campaigns. The results compare well with simultaneous IR-radiometer cloud measurements as well as measurements made in ice-clouds using aircraft mounted 2D probe particle-sizing instruments. In addition, the reflectivities calculated from the in-situ measurements alone are seen to consistent with the observed reflectivities
